Transaction 966818215062cc1988f734e0cc97966bbdd4c6d33830e02ec08444fe3a70b953
1 Input
1 Output
-
966818215062cc1988f734e0cc97966bbdd4c6d33830e02ec08444fe3a70b953:0
- value
- 4576855
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6cd367adfbfc117940dcc9dbaf6ce4305e622f63 OP_EQUAL
- address
- 3BcS9wNX13tbsKM4xGYPkadTPnyxVuLhuw